Method For Treatment And Prevention Of Bacterial Vaginosis

Method For Treatment And Prevention Of Bacterial Vaginosis

Abstract:
Methods for treatment and prevention of bacterial vaginosis are described. In order to treat a patient diagnosed with bacterial vaginosis, an antibiotic is administered to the patient and all infected participant-partners. Bacterial vaginosis is prevented in a human patient planning to participate in activities in which the patient's vagina may be contacted directly or indirectly by oral flora from a participant by cleansing the mouths of the patient and the patient's partner with an oral antiseptic prior to engaging in the activities.
